Section 1: Decoding the Fractal Code - Unraveling the Mathematics Behind Folk Art
The Undergraduate Certificate in Fractal Patterns in Folk Art begins by introducing students to the fundamental principles of fractal geometry. By analyzing the self-similar patterns found in folk art, students gain a deeper understanding of the mathematical concepts that underlie these intricate designs. From the recursive patterns in African textiles to the geometric motifs in Islamic art, students learn to decode the fractal code that governs these traditional art forms. This newfound understanding enables them to appreciate the ingenuity and creativity of folk artists, who have been intuitively applying fractal principles in their work for centuries.
Section 2: Digital Folkloristics - The Rise of Technology in Fractal Pattern Analysis
The advent of digital technologies has revolutionized the field of fractal pattern analysis in folk art. With the aid of computer software and algorithms, researchers can now analyze and visualize fractal patterns with unprecedented precision. This has led to the emergence of digital folkloristics, a subfield that combines traditional folkloric methods with cutting-edge digital tools. Students in the Undergraduate Certificate program learn to harness these technologies to uncover new insights into the fractal patterns that underlie folk art. From 3D scanning and printing to machine learning and data visualization, students gain hands-on experience with the latest digital tools and techniques.
